SR 1065: National Crime Victim's Rights Week; recognize April 19-25, 2026; the victim advocates of the Cobb County Solicitor General's Office; commend

Última acción: 31 de marzo de 2026 · Senate Read and Adopted

A Georgia Senate resolution recognizes April 19-25, 2026 as National Crime Victim's Rights Week and commends victim advocates at the Cobb County Solicitor General's Office for their work supporting crime victims.

En lenguaje claro

This resolution from the Georgia Senate designates April 19-25, 2026 as National Crime Victim's Rights Week, an annual observance meant to highlight victims' rights and honor those who support them. It specifically praises the team of victim advocates working in the Cobb County Solicitor General's Office, naming Director of Victim Services Sirpa Vigdorov and advocates Meghan Abstein, Stephanie Beatty, Chloe Chin, Erika Chukwura, Jazmine Guaman, and Bianca Lopez for helping crime victims access resources, understand their legal rights, and recover from their experiences. The resolution does not change any Georgia law. It formally thanks these named advocates for their service and directs the Secretary of the Senate to distribute copies of the resolution to the public and press.

Por qué importa

This is a ceremonial resolution rather than a change to Georgia law. It publicly recognizes the work of a specific group of victim advocates and marks a national awareness week, which can raise visibility for victim services but does not alter funding, rights, or procedures.
